Things are looking up for the Italian airport system, due to increases in incoming tourists and exports of Italian products to the rest of the world. The details on air traffic for 2016 were published in a report by Assaeroporti (the airport management association).
The general outlook
In comparison to 2015, passenger traffic has grown by 4.6%; the total volume of transported goods is up +5.9%; and the number of takeoffs/landings has increased by 2.6%. Specifically, 164.69 million passengers went through the 36 Italian airports monitored by Assaeroporti—around 7.5 million more than in 2015.
